"I wouldn't have done it"  Steven Gerrard opens up on Trent Alexander-Arnold's shock Real Madrid move
"This is me speaking without my Liverpool hat on at the moment, he began. Real Madrid came for me with Mourinho, serious. And it turned my head. I can understand it. I get it. His best mate plays there. Maybe he wants to challenge himself. He's won everything at Liverpool. So there's a part of me that really understands it."
"But as soon as I put my Liverpool hat back on, I think, what are you doing? What are you doing? You're arguably one of the best teams in Europe. You're winning things that I still dream of winning. You're one of the main men. The fans adore you. What are you doing? But this is with my Liverpool hat on, because I love Liverpool Football Club"
Trent Alexander-Arnold refused to sign a new contract and completed a free transfer to Real Madrid after running down his Liverpool deal. Liverpool secured a token fee of £8.4 million so Madrid could register him for the Club World Cup, far less than his market value. The decision angered many Liverpool supporters and damaged his hometown-hero status, drawing criticism from former players including Jamie Carragher. Steven Gerrard expressed understanding of Alexander-Arnold's motivations, noting Real Madrid's appeal, a close teammate at the club, and a desire for new challenges, while also saying he would have chosen differently wearing his Liverpool perspective.
